What is digitization?

Digitization is the process of converting information from a physical format, such as paper documents, photographs, or analog recordings, into a digital format that can be stored, processed, and accessed electronically. This process often involves scanning, photographing, or using specialized equipment to create digital files. Digitization enables easier sharing, preservation, and retrieval of information, making it widely used in industries like libraries, archives, healthcare, and business. It also helps protect original materials from wear and tear by reducing the need for direct handling.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a digitization spec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Digitization Specialist, you need expertise in document handling, digital archiving, and data management, often supported by a relevant degree or experience in library science or information technology. Familiarity with scanning equipment, digital asset management systems (DAMS), and metadata standards such as Dublin Core is typically required. Attention to detail, organizational skills, and effective communication help ensure accuracy and smooth project workflows. These skills are vital for preserving information integrity, ensuring accessibility, and supporting the successful transition from physical to digital formats.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in digitization roles,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als working in digitization often encounter challenges such as handling fragile or outdated source materials, ensuring data accuracy during conversion, and managing large volumes of documents efficiently. Addressing these issues typically involves adopting best practices for document handling, leveraging advanced scanning and OCR technologies, and implementing thorough quality control processes. Collaboration with IT teams and archivists is also essential to ensure that digital assets are well-organized, securely stored, and easily accessible for future use.

What is the difference between Digitization vs Data Entry Specialist?

AspectDigitizationData Entry Specialist
Primary FocusConverting physical or analog data into digital formatsInputting data into digital systems accurately and efficiently
Required SkillsTechnical skills, familiarity with scanning and OCR toolsTyping speed, attention to detail, data management
Work EnvironmentOften involves working with scanning equipment, software, and digital platformsOffice setting, using computers and data management software
Common CertificationsNone typically required, but technical certifications can helpNone typically required, but certifications in data management can be advantageous

While both roles involve working with digital data, digitization focuses on converting physical or analog data into digital formats, often involving technical tools and processes. Data entry specialists primarily focus on accurately inputting data into systems.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or job role.
